If it was made for ReShade 3 it won't work in ReShade 2. You can, however, import ReShade 1 presets over to ReShade 2. But if you take 10 minutes to learn the program, it's as easy as copying the settings used in ReShade 3 to the equivalents of ReShade 2. The actual shaders stay the mostly the same, it's just the injector dll that changes each time.

With that said, I don't think the 'Clarity, Emphasize, MXAO,' shaders exist in older ReShade versions. For a similar effect, poke around with the Curves, Lumasharpen, and Tonemap settings. They're easy to figure out if you know anything about how digital images work.
